3.2.3 Clutch control

3.2.3.1 General information

Clutch control is carried out in the following way:
When you press pedal pad 6 (figure 3.2.4) arm 5 shifts and rotates lever 1, connected
through control shaft 18 (figure 3.2.1) to the clutch coupling shifter. In this case the clutch dis-
engages.
When you release pedal 6 (figure 3.2.4) the clutch engages.

3.2.3.2 Adjustment of clutch coupling pedal free travel

ATTENTION: TOO SUBSTANTIAL PEDAL TRAVEL WILL NOT ALLOW TO DISEN-
GAGE THE CLUTCH FULLY AND WILL HAMPER GEAR SHIFTING. ABSENCE OF FREE
PEDAL TRAVEL WILL LEAD TO COUPLING DISCS SLIPPING, AND RAPID WEAR OF THE
DISCS AND OVERHEATING OF CLUTCH PARTS!
Clutch pedal free travel, measured with non-running engine, shall be within the limits
from 40 to 50 mm. If this value is too high or too low, adjust clutch pedal free travel.
To adjust free travel proceed as follows:
- loosen lock nut 4 (figure 3.2.4) of fork 3, unlock and remove pin 2, disconnecting
arm 5 from lever 1;
- unscrew adjusting bolt 8 until pedal 6 touches floor of the cabin;
- turn lever 1 anticlockwise against the stop, that is until the release bearing touches
CC release levers;
- adjust length of arm 5, rotating fork 3 until holes in the fork align with the holes in
lever 1. Then screw in fork 3 five turns (shorten the arm).
- tighten lock nut 4, connect fork 3 to lever 1 with the help of pin 2.
If your tractor is equipped with the creeper, then to avoid hanging of pedal 6 it is
necessary to install up to four washers 11. Decrease of clutch pedal free travel up to 35 mm is
allowed.
ATTENTION: MAKE SURE THAT THE CLUTCH PEDAL SAFELY RETURNS ALL THE
WAY UNTIL IT STOPS AGAINST THE FLOOR IN THE AREA OF PEDAL FREE TRAVEL.
OTHERWISE, ADJUST FORCE OF THE SPRING OF SERVO 7 (FIGURE 3.2.4) WITH THE
HELP OF BOLT 8 OR CHANGE THE POSITION OF BRACKET 9, TURNING IT ANTI-
CLOCKWISE RELATIVE TO THE AXIS OF THE MOUNTING BOLT!
